Elections
2012
Edmonds is not running for re-election in the 2012 election for the Wyoming House of Representatives District 12.[2]
2010
Edmonds was re-elected to the Wyoming House of Representatives, District 12. She defeated Democrat Robert Aylward in the November 2, 2010 general election. She was unopposed in the August 17, 2010 primary. [3][4]

Campaign donors
2010
In 2010, Edmonds received $10,100 in campaign donations. The top contributors are listed below.[5]

2008
In 2008, Edmonds collected $18,575 in campaign contributions.[6] The four largest contributors to her campaign were as follows:
